Compare all specifications:
2004 Mitsubishi Endeavor | 1967 Pontiac GTO | |
Make | Mitsubishi | Pontiac |
Model | Endeavor | GTO |
Year Released | 2004 | 1967 |
Body Type | SUV | Coupe |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 3835 cc | 6375 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 8 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| V |
Valves per Cylinder | 4 valves | 2 valves |
Horse Power | 225 HP | 0 HP |
Drive Type | 4WD | Rear |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 4 seats |
Number of Doors | 5 doors | 2 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1875 kg | 1400 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4840 mm | 5250 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1880 mm | 1900 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1790 mm | 1380 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2730 mm | 2930 mm |
